The Properly Equipped Operator
Wear hearing protection devices and a
Wear close-fitting clothing to protect legs and arms.
Gloves offer added protection and are strongly
recommended. Do not wear clothing or jewelry
that could get caught in machinery or
underbrush. Secure long hair so that it
is above shoulder level.
NEVER wear shorts!
Keep a proper footing and do not overreach.
Maintain your balance at all times during
operation.
Wear appropriate footwear
(non-skid boots or shoes): do not
wear open-toed shoes or sandals.
Never work barefooted!
Be Aware of the Working Environment
Avoid long-term
operation in very hot or
very cold weather.
If contact is made with a hard
object, stop the engine and
inspect the cutting attachment
for damage.
Be extremely careful of
slippery terrain, especially
during rainy weather.
Be constantly alert for objects and
debris that could be thrown either from
the rotating cutting attachment or bounced
from a hard surface.
